This patch removes the loophole to leave resource requests and limits
unspecified in managed apps. Any of cpu, memory, and ephemeral storage
are now filled in from the resource preset (default or user-specified)
if not explicitly specified in .Values.resources. "none" is no longer an
accepted value in resourcePresets and the primary resources now always
have some explicit value for proper billing and isolation.

This patch introduces reusable library charts that provide
backward-compatibility for users that specify their resources as
explicit requests and limits for cpu, however this input is processed so
that limits are set equal to requests except for CPU which only gets
requests. Users can now embrace the new form by directly specifying
resources in the first level of nesting (e.g. resources.cpu=100m instead
of .resources.requests.cpu=100m). The order of precedence is top-level,
then requests, then limits, ensuring that nothing will break in terms of
scheduling, however workloads that specified limits much higher than
requests might get a performance hit, now that they cannot use all this
excess capacity. This should only affect memory-hungry workloads in
low-contention environments.

This patch recreates the resource presets with a non-burstable memory
allocation (request==limit) and without CPU limits. With the new presets
the difference between the larger presets became meaningless, so their
values were adjusted.
